Grella scores fastest goal in MLS history

Mike Grella has broken Tim Cahill’s Major League Soccer record, scoring within seven seconds for the New York Red Bulls.

The attacker now holds the record for the quickest ever goal in the competition as his side went on to beat Philadelphia Union 4-1 over the weekend.

Grella raced to the ball and attacked the open lane after flat-footed midfielder Michael Lahoud allowed the initial backpass to roll past him. With Steven Vitoria backpedalling, Grella juked left and sent a left-footed shot deflecting off the defender and past goalkeeper Andre Blake.

Tim Cahill’s previous record stood at eight seconds.
